What is teeth chart baby?
Teeth chart baby, also known as a baby teeth eruption chart or a baby teeth timeline, is a graphical representation of the different stages of tooth development in infants and young children. It helps parents and caregivers track the growth of their child's teeth and monitor their oral health.
What are the types of teeth chart baby?
There are several types of teeth chart baby that parents can use to keep track of their child's dental milestones. Some popular types include:
Traditional teeth chart: This chart displays the primary teeth (also called baby teeth) and their eruption sequence. It helps parents anticipate when their child might start teething and identify any potential issues.
Interactive teeth chart: This digital chart allows parents to input their child's specific tooth eruption dates and receive personalized notifications and reminders.
Tooth eruption app: Mobile applications provide an interactive way to track tooth development. They often include additional features like oral hygiene tips and teething remedies.
Printable teeth chart: These charts can be downloaded and printed for easy reference. They usually include images of primary teeth and spaces to record eruption dates.
